12 U.S.C. § 1801 to 1805 - Omitted

Notes

Editorial Notes

Codification Sections, acts Feb. 24, 1945, ch. 4, §§ 1, 2, 4, 5, 59 Stat. 5, 6; Apr. 25, 1945, ch. 95, title I, 59 Stat. 81, related to the Federal Loan Agency which was established by Reorg. Plan No. I of 1939, § 402, set out in the Appendix to Title 5, Government Organization and Employees, and continued as an independent establishment of the Government by act Feb. 24, 1945, ch. 4, 59 Stat. 5, and was abolished by section 204 of act June 30, 1947, ch. 166, title II, 61 Stat. 208, and its property and records were transferred to the Reconstruction Finance Corporation. By act June 24, 1954, ch. 410, § 2(a), 68 Stat. 320, section 609 of Title 15, Commerce and Trade, the Secretary of the Treasury was authorized to liquidate the Reconstruction Finance Corporation. Section 6(a) of Reorg. Plan No. 1 of 1957, eff. June 30, 1957, 22 F.R. 4633, 71 Stat. 647, set out as a note under section 601 of Title 15, Commerce and Trade, abolished the Reconstruction Finance Corporation.
